Write T for true or F for false. 1. Chinna wanted to buy the bells to attach them to his bicycle.

  • 1

This statement is false. Chinna wanted to buy the tinkling bells for his pet goat named Tara, not for a bicycle. He saw the shiny bells at Chacha’s shop and thought they would look lovely on Tara’s neck.
